Suggestion Therapy
Installing specific, agreed-on new beliefs or behaviors during trance, often via a personalized recording the client listens to daily.
Suggestion therapy is the reconditioning phase. After the root has been addressed, the new pattern is reinforced through repeated exposure during the brain's most receptive states — typically a 21-day recording protocol.

Clinical Hypnotherapy
A regulated therapeutic use of trance to access and reshape subconscious patterns. Not stage hypnosis.
RTT (Rapid Transformational Therapy)
A hybrid modality combining hypnotherapy, NLP, CBT and psychotherapy into a results-focused protocol.
Anchoring
Tying a desired state (calm, focus, confidence) to a deliberate cue so it's available on demand.
